How much do marketing advertising director j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 25, 2026, the average yearly pay for marketing advertising director in the United States is $86,136.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$75,500.00 and $113,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a marketing advertising director do?

A Marketing Advertising Director oversees the strategy, planning, and execution of marketing and advertising campaigns for an organization or client. They lead teams to develop creative concepts, manage budgets, analyze market trends, and ensure campaigns align with business goals. Their responsibilities often include collaborating with other departments, evaluating campaign performance, and maintaining relationships with media vendors and agencies. Ultimately, they are responsible for maximizing brand awareness and driving business growth through effective marketing and advertising initiatives.

What are some common challenges faced by marketing advertising directors when managing cross-functional teams?

Marketing Advertising Directors often face challenges in aligning the goals and timelines of diverse teams, such as creative, media buying, and analytics. Coordinating communication among departments, ensuring consistent brand messaging, and managing tight deadlines are typical hurdles. Building strong relationships and fostering collaboration are essential to overcome these challenges and keep campaigns on track. Additionally, adapting to fast-changing market trends and client expectations requires agility and effective problem-solving sk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a marketing advertising director,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Marketing Advertising Director, you need expertise in marketing strategy, campaign management, and a strong background often supported by a degree in marketing, communications, or a related field. Familiarity with digital marketing platforms, analytics tools like Google Analytics, and advertising management systems is typically required, along with relevant certifications such as Google Ads or HubSpot. Exceptional leadership, creativity, and communication skills help you inspire teams and drive effective brand messaging. These skills are crucial for developing impactful campaigns that achieve organizational goals and ensure a competitive market presence.

POSITION SUMMARY

Under the direction of the Assistant Advertising Director, the Advertising Specialist supports the execution of the Casino's traditional advertising and media efforts across broadcast, print, radio, outdoor, direct mail, and other non-digital channels. This role coordinates the day-to-day trafficking, placement, and tracking of advertising, assists with media buying and vendor coordination, and helps ensure campaigns are deployed accurately, on brand, and on schedule in support of property business goals. The Advertising Specialist works in coordination with the in-house creative team, who own creative asset development, to move advertising from plan to placement.
